I've done two treatments of the Erbium laser a few years ago. honestly bros...the shit works...but the downtime is a killer! And don't forget about how red your skin is after the treatment. Nobody bothered telling me about the "residual redness" from laser treatments...its been about two years now and the redness is almost gone now. I'm talkin bright ass red to..not just a little rosey! So just think it through guys...it works...but you won't see the benefits until at least a year after the procedure. Those chicks on those make over shows look great after their laser treatments because after they heal they slap buckets of makeup on their face to hid the redness. Do a little research into plastic surgery...you can find some people who have posted their worst experiences with lasers talking about how much they regret the process...while others say it was the best thing that happened to them. Your best bet would be a plastic surgeon who doesn't go so deep with the laser, but beleives in conservative treatments....you can always go back and do it again. good luck!

there are huge differences in the TYPES of lasers as well... some require recovery, some do not... current laser treatments for rosacea for instance, do not require recovery, are only about $250 each and usually work within 4 treatments, and last indefinitely depending on how bad your condition is.
